This project was a labor of love that took four months of dedicated craftsmanship to complete. Below, we share the detailed, step-by-step journey of how our artists transformed a simple vision into this breathtaking Palki Sahib.
Phase 1: Planning and Artistic Design
-
Step 1 & 2: Our artists began with detailed hand-drawn plans. The final approved design is a grand structure measuring 12ft wide, 12ft deep, and 14ft high.
-
Step 3: These drawings were given to master wood carvers who hand-carved the patterns onto MDF boards to create the very first molds.
Phase 2: Molding and Casting
-
Step 4 & 5: We created high-quality silicon fiber molds. From these, we cast 4 massive pillars, 8 top sections (for both the inside and outside), and 4 inner arches (mehrabs).
-
Step 6: To ensure the structure is strong and looks thick, we built a 2-layer Mild Steel (MS) frame. This frame holds the inner and outer silicon fiber shells together.
Phase 3: Refinement and Finishing
-
Step 7 & 8: Every section was hand-rubbed to make the surface perfectly smooth. We applied a PU primer and used specialized putty to fill any tiny pinholes, ensuring a flawless base.
-
Step 9: Once smooth, we sprayed the first coat of beautiful golden paint on every piece.
Phase 4: Assembly and Quality Testing
-
Step 10 & 11: After drying under the sun, we performed a full test assembly. We used a crane to lift the heavy top section onto the pillars to check the structural strength and bolting.
-

Phase 5: Final Coating and Shipping
-
Step 13 & 14: The Palki Sahib was disassembled so we could apply a perfect second coat of golden paint, fixing any small scratches from the assembly process.
-
Step 15: Finally, a clear coat of lacquer was sprayed to give it a lasting shine and protection.
-
Step 16: Each section is now being carefully packaged individually to be loaded into a container for its long journey to Indianapolis.
